I don't know about their reputation, but they are definitely inclusionary policies and I get very nervous when they have short lists of included parts and it's comprised of such things as "start motor housing and all internal components" then items like "field windings". Those types of detailed lists make me wonder if external connectors, wiring, brackets, etc are covered. Maybe not important, but I've had a policy almost identical to this before for a Jeep and while it saved me major expense (it was a Jeep after all) I usually ended up with several $100 of "not specifically called out on the policy" components at each repair.

I'm also wary of "sold only through dealers". That means to me high mark ups and having to haggle. The DC policy does seem to carry with it a good reputation and a fair price. It's not clearly the exclusionary policy the seller says it is (IMO), but I'm not sure how much more I would be willing to pay for the extra piece of mind. I've got 4 weeks to decide, but I'm currently leaning towards the DC policy.
